2. Simple Exercises
Easy-to-do exercises prevent problems, heal injuries, and enhance the strength of the hypermobile body.
When done thoughtfully, movement becomes medicine. Even if exercise sounds impossible while you suffer with pain and fatigue, there are easy exercises that can make a huge difference. These exercises aren’t about intense cardio or lifting heavy weights—they’re about:
Releasing and toning the fascia that may be causing a lot of pain and stiffness
Activating stabilizing muscles that will protect your joints
Moving in ways that restore joint alignment and reduce pain
